A safety switch (RCD) monitors the electricity flowing through your circuits and cuts the power within milliseconds if it detects a fault, such as current leaking to earth through a person. It’s different from a circuit breaker, which protects your wiring from overload. A safe home needs both.

When the work is finished, we provide a Certificate of Compliance for Electrical Work, the document that confirms the installation is safe and meets the wiring rules.
It matters for more than peace of mind. A compliance certificate is the record that the work was done to standard, which is important for your home insurance and useful if you ever sell.

Flickering lights and frequent tripping usually point to an overloaded circuit, a faulty appliance or an ageing switchboard. It’s worth having checked, because it can signal a fault that gets worse over time. We diagnose the cause and carry out the repairs as booked, business-hours work.
You likely need an upgrade if your board still has ceramic fuses, has no safety switches (RCDs), trips regularly, or you’re adding a big load like solar or an EV charger. Safety switches cut the power in a fraction of a second to protect your family, and a modern board handles today’s demands. See our switchboard upgrades page to learn more.
NSW law requires a working smoke alarm on every storey of a home. Interconnected alarms, where one sounding sets off all the others, are required for new builds and homes undergoing significant renovation, and they’re widely recommended for existing homes because they give the earliest warning. We install compliant interconnected alarms to bring your home up to standard.
